Foundation Excavation in Houston, TX
Foundation excavation services involve the careful removal of soil and debris around a property's foundation to prepare for repairs, extensions, or new construction. This process is essential for projects such as foundation repair, basement excavation, or installing new footings, ensuring a stable and level base for the structure.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of excavation, the impact on their landscape, and any necessary preparations before work begins, such as access points or utility considerations.
Before requesting foundation excavation, homeowners should consider factors like the extent of excavation needed, potential disruptions to landscaping or utilities, and the importance of proper grading afterward. Clear communication about the project's goals and any existing structural concerns can help ensure the excavation supports long-term stability and safety. Understanding these aspects can facilitate a smooth process and help property owners make informed decisions about their foundation-related projects.

Common Foundation Excavation Jobs
Foundation excavation involves removing soil to prepare for new or replacement foundations.
Basement excavation includes digging out space for basement construction or expansion.
Pier and beam foundation excavation involves exposing and preparing supports for stability.
Slab foundation excavation includes site prep for concrete slabs in new construction.
Retaining wall excavation involves trenching for structural supports to prevent soil erosion.
Drainage and utility trenching prepares the site for proper water management and utility installation.
Foundation Excavation Questions
What types of projects require foundation excavation? Foundation excavation is needed for new construction, foundation repairs, or basement additions to prepare the site and ensure stability.
How deep does foundation excavation typically go? The depth varies based on the foundation design and soil conditions but generally ranges from a few feet to over ten feet.
What should property owners consider before starting excavation? It's important to evaluate soil stability, nearby structures, and drainage to ensure proper excavation and foundation support.
Is foundation excavation safe for existing structures? Proper planning and techniques help protect existing structures during excavation, minimizing the risk of damage.
